Medford American Little League (MALL) includes baseball and softball divisions for all children, ages 4–16 residing in Medford (East of I-5) and White City. In addition to practicing on-field fundamentals and the excitement of playing games in a competitive environment, MALL pridefully enlists the sport to strengthen its participants’ self-esteem and confidence.
Regardless of physical size, skill, strength, gender, religion, or nationality, MALL offers the opportunity for a child to experience and benefit from the life lessons, socialization, and camaraderie that are the cornerstones of the program.
MALL is a community baseball and softball program operated by parents and local volunteers, supported by local businesses and is dedicated to providing any child with a fun and engaging youth sports environment.
Registration typically opens in December of the year before, and runs through mid-February prior to the start of the Spring season. Practices are in March, and regular season games are in April and May on weeknights and Saturdays.
Requests for players to play up a division or down a division may be made by
contacting the MALL board. Decisions are at the sole discretion of the MALL board. Player safety - that of the player making the request as well as other players on the field - is taken into consideration when making this decision.
